Hidden DNA can be used to predict whether a patient will have a recurrence of cancer

According to the team, chemotherapy is an incredibly powerful tool for killing cancer cells, but also

ordinary cells also fall under its effect, and this can lead to serious negative consequences. 

Now a new study has presented a methodwhich has already helped some patients with stage II colon cancer avoid chemotherapy. Their clinical results did not change in any way. 

This is not the first work to explorecirculating DNA - ctDNA. According to scientists, the presence of ctDNA in the bloodstream after surgery predicts the risk of cancer recurrence. The new study adds to and complements this knowledge.

It is known that approximately 75% of people with colon cancerStage II colons do not require chemotherapy after surgery, but 25% do need it. Therefore, it is important for doctors to understand who will benefit most from chemotherapy and who will only be harmed by it. 

As a result, a ctDNA-based approach to the treatment of stage II colon cancer has helped reduce the use of adjuvant chemotherapy without compromising patient survival.
